About 24 Birch Road
24 Birch Road is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Wolverhampton (WV11 2EZ). It has a recorded floor area of 74 m² (around 797 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(March 2014) shows a C (score 71). The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since November 2009. Between certificates, window efficiency dropped from Good to Average and h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 86). The latest certificate is from March 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 70% of similar EPCs). Across 2010–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.4%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£196,000 is 15.3% above the 2023 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£213/sq ft) was about 64.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old January 2023 for £170,000.
